| Any idea what this is? Found it in a stone crab trap yesterday. I was thinking it's in the bass family or grouper family but I can't find a picture that matches it. Thanks for the help. Reef Safe or not? |
| Sponsored Links |
| |
| ||||
| Soapfish, Rypticus sp. Not particularily reef safe - will eat small fish and shrimp, and as their name implies, can release a foul substance from their skin. Jay |
